Why Scaling Energy Storage Matters Now

Did you know the global energy storage market will grow by 21% annually through 2030? With solar and wind projects expanding faster than ever, we're facing a make-or-break moment: our grids need storage solutions that can handle gigawatt-hour capacities without breaking the bank.

The Bottlenecks We Can't Ignore

  • Material shortages (lithium-ion batteries need 500% more lithium by 2030)
  • Safety concerns in dense urban deployments
  • Efficiency losses in multi-hour storage cycles

Emerging Solutions Breaking Barriers

Three technologies changing the game:

  1. Sand Batteries: Stores heat at 500°C using low-cost materials
  2. Gravity Storage: Uses abandoned mineshafts for weight-based systems
  3. Hydrogen Hybrids: Combines electrolysis with battery buffers
